    Cavalry PISTOL model An XIII
    France
    First Empire
    Steel, wood, brass
    Overall length: 35; Barrel length: 19.7 cm
    Caliber: 17 mm

    Round barrel ending in flats, marked "1813" on the left side, control stamp on top.
    Flintlock lock with heart hammer and straight crest, signed "Mre Imple de Tulle".
    Brass counterplate and trigger guard.
    Wooden frame.
    Nailhead" steel ramrod.
    Test marks.
